Tips for Maintaining the Appearance of Dark-colored Corian Surfaces

Dark-colored Corian surfaces are a popular choice for kitchens and bathrooms due to their sleek appearance and durability. However, maintaining their appearance requires proper care and attention. Here are some essential tips to keep your dark Corian surfaces looking their best.

Regular Cleaning

Consistent cleaning helps prevent the buildup of dirt, stains, and streaks. Use a soft cloth or sponge with mild soap and warm water to clean the surface regularly. Avoid abrasive cleaners or pads that can scratch the surface.

Immediate Spill Cleanup

Dark surfaces show water spots and stains more prominently. Wipe up spills immediately, especially those from coffee, wine, or other pigmented liquids. This prevents staining and keeps the surface looking uniform.

Use of Proper Cleaning Products

Choose non-abrasive, pH-balanced cleaners specifically designed for Corian or solid surface countertops. Avoid harsh chemicals like bleach or acetone, which can damage the finish and cause discoloration.

Protective Measures

Use cutting boards and trivets to prevent scratches and heat damage. Avoid placing hot pots directly on the surface, as excessive heat can cause discoloration or warping.

Addressing Stains and Scratches

If stains or scratches occur, gentle polishing with a non-abrasive pad or a Corian-specific cleaner can help restore the surface. For deeper scratches or stains, consult a professional for repair options.
